BrickCon 2009 is looking for any talks, roundtables, and special
activities you would like to see at the Con this year.  Going to and
putting on sessions are one of the things that makes a Lego convention
fun.

Past talks have included manufacturing custom parts, an introduction to
LDraw, and packing Lego models for shipment, among many others.

Roundtables, or moderated discussions, have included Moonbase standards
and design, landscaping, and anything that someone can think of.

Activities already planned for this year include the Dirty Brickster and
the Wacky Race.

All we need for more talks, roundtables, and activities are ideas and
people to run with them.  Projectors and a computer will be available
(although bringing your own laptop ensures compatibility).  All spaces can
be configured with tables and chairs as desired.

Any registered attendee who would like to run a presentation or activity
should e-mail proposals or questions to me (my first three initials @
morfydd.net---please mention BrickCon in the subject).  If possible,
please include a possible title, brief description for the event program,
and any time constraints or facility requirements.  Events are typically
scheduled to run up to fifty minutes but can be scheduled for more or
less time.

I need proposals by September 6 to have time to prepare the schedule and
the program.  Earlier is better.

BrickCon is an annual adult Lego hobbyist convention and exposition in
Seattle.  BrickCon 2009 will be October 1--4, 2009, in the Seattle Center
Exhibition Hall.  For more information or to register visit
http://www.brickcon.org/
